PRATÜM is a reflection of where I come from—a story rooted in the sweeping prairies of central Iowa. The name, Latin for "prairie," speaks to the landscape that shaped my identity and inspires every thread of my work.
Growing up on a small farm just outside of town, I was surrounded by the textures and colors of the land. Our family home sat on a hill, encircled by two acres of tallgrass prairie—native grasslands alive with big-stem bluegrass and wildflowers like bergamot. The air carried the unmistakable scents of turned earth, rain, and fresh garden tomatoes. Those sensory experiences are etched into my memory and have become the heart of PRATUM.
There’s a profound sense of belonging that comes from standing in the prairie, looking out at the horizon as far as the eye can see—especially when a storm rolls in. At PRATUM, we believe that if necessity is the mother of invention, then passion is the father of innovation. The need for sustainable and ethical production has never been greater, and we are committed to answering that call.
We reject mass production and overproduction. Every garment is made to order, ensuring we create only what is truly needed. Our commitment to small-batch production allows us to maintain exceptional quality control while significantly reducing resource waste.

PRATUM partners with small factories and workshops to craft garments of the highest quality while maintaining the smallest possible carbon footprint. Our production process incorporates numerous artisanal techniques, many performed by hand rather than machines. This approach not only upholds traditional craftsmanship but also minimizes greenhouse gas emissions and reduces non-recyclable waste.
